Output 729581b21655159aca3c986e57c63d580cd96270324562aec0ba7ec0c261625e:0

value
1000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 90dadbe1b912973d9e8d7aa792cbd1990d00b324 OP_EQUALVERIFY OP_CHECKSIG
address
1ECvVD2r8GVv6ydtJEhUY1ccUD4Mspadec
transaction
729581b21655159aca3c986e57c63d580cd96270324562aec0ba7ec0c261625e
spent
true